Please go make yet more sure, and know and see his place where his haunt is, and who has seen him there; for I have been told that he deals very crafty.
1 Samuel 23:22 · World English Bible
Parallel translations
  • KJV Go, I pray you, prepare yet, and know and see his place where his haunt is, and who hath seen him there: for it is told me that he dealeth very subtilly.
  • BSB Please go and prepare further. Investigate and watch carefully where he goes and who has seen him there, for I am told that he is extremely cunning.
  • NKJV Please go and find out for sure, and see the place where his hideout is, and who has seen him there. For I am told he is very crafty.
  • NASB Go now, be more persistent, and investigate and see his place where he is hiding, and who has seen him there; for I am told that he is very cunning.
  • NLT Go and check again to be sure of where he is staying and who has seen him there, for I know that he is very crafty.
